What companies run services between Palu, Indonesia and Bontang, Indonesia?

There is no direct connection from Palu to Bontang. However, you can take the taxi to Mutiara Sis Al-Jufrie Airport (PLW) airport, fly to Aji Pangeran Tumenggung Pranoto International Airport (AAP), then take the taxi to Bontang. Alternatively, you can drive to Pantoloan, take the ferry to Balikpapan, drive to Balikpapan, take the bus to Samarinda, then take the taxi to Bontang.
